Sacrifice Zhao Shi Gu Er Chinese Peking Opera Takefu Garment Costumes and Headwear
The Takefu costume is a traditional Chinese opera costume worn by male actors in the Beijing opera.
It is characterized by its bright colors, intricate embroidery, and flowing lines.
The headwear, such as the tasseled cap and feathered headdress, adds to the overall aesthetic of the costume.
The Takefu costume has a rich cultural history and significance in Chinese opera.
It represents the noble and powerful characters that are often portrayed in Beijing opera, such as kings, generals, and heroes.
The intricate embroidery and flowing lines also symbolize the elegance and grace of these characters.
In addition to its cultural significance, the Takefu costume is also a work of art.
Its bright colors and intricate design make it a visually stunning piece of clothing.
It is often used in performances to create a sense of grandeur and majesty.
